MoSi2 heating elements is a high temperature component with MoSi2 as its basic material . If it can be correctly use. I.E. Combining completely with heat model , the highest temperature can up to 1850°C. MoSi2 heating elements is brittleness and hardness under high temperature meanwhile Bend strength is lower than usual . Because the plasticity of elements will become soft above 1350ºC . elements can be curved and form wished shape under high temperature.Elements is used in high temperature under the oxidizing atmosphere, its surface form a light SiO2 glass film which can protect the element not to be oxidized

Application
MoSi2 heating elements is widely used in various industries of metallurgy , glass , ceramic, magnetic materials , heat-resistant material , etc. According to shape , it can be divide into "pole " "U" "W". Special shape such as right angle shape and bend angle shape can be produced according to customer's request. Because the plasticity of element will soft above 1350°C .We often see "U" and "W" type .
Advantages
Mosi2 heating element can quickly form a thin and adhesive anti-oxidizing layer of quartz glass(Sio2), under the high temperature oxidizing condition. If the protective layer was damaged, the element can reform a new one, so Mosi2 heating element has a very good anti-oxidation properties, it also means that the heating element can be used on operation for a much longer time than the traditional one.
The resistivity of the Mosi2 heating element is not changing with the time, so a new one can be installed without effecting the old one, this can result of huge saving in furnace maintenance fee sand time as well, increase the working efficiency, this is the key point of Mosi2 heating element being a better material and being widely used.

Recommend surface load:
Furnace Temp(°c) |
1400 |
1500 |
1600 |
1650 |
1700 |
Surface load of hot zone(W/cm²) |
<18 |
<15 |
<12 |
<10 |
<8 |
Chemical Properties
Oxygen-resistance under high temperature: in oxidizing atmosphere, a layer of compact quartz (SiO2) protective film is formed on the surface of element owing to the high-temperature combustion, which prevent Mosi from continuously oxidizing. When the element temperature is higher than 1700ºC, the SiO2 protective film will be fused because fused because its fusing point is 1710ºC and the SiO2 is fused into molten drops owing to the action of its surface extension, which cause losing its protective ability. In the oxidizing atmosphere, when the element is contiguously used, the protective film forms again.
It should be pointed out that element cannot be used for rather long time in 400-700ºC. Otherwise, it will be powdered owing to the strong oxidizing action in low temperature.
Installation Instructions
Installation of mosi2 heating element
1)Vertically hanging
Under normal temperature, MoSi2 element is very brittleness, while under high temperature, it is plasticity, so the better way to install U Shape element is to hang it vertically from the furnace top through the support clamping chuck. The aim of such way is to avoid putting the mechanical stress directly to the element heat-generating end; otherwise the element will easily be broken.
2) Support clamp
Support clamp are applied to 9/18 and 6/12 two kinds of elements respectively. The support clamp supports the whole weight of the element and the position of the element is also determined by it, therefore, it must be installed carefully to assure the element vertically hung. In order to prevent the element from being over heated locally, the taper part of the element lower end must put into the furnace chamber.
